Output 86eb8f269fa544fc1763845c1854d83e427cc1026c536fb2ed152027605bf088:21

value
11881
script pubkey
OP_0 OP_PUSHBYTES_20 3dd3ccacb73a495c7ceb8dde745c978ccfb91074
address
bc1q8hfuet9h8fy4cl8t3h08ghyh3n8mjyr53n3dr9
transaction
86eb8f269fa544fc1763845c1854d83e427cc1026c536fb2ed152027605bf088